What is Ryujinx?

Ryujinx, a popular Nintendo Switch emulator, is known for providing an excellent gaming experience. However, some users encounter Ryujinx crashing or freezing issues. This can be due to various factors, including hardware compatibility, software conflicts, or corrupted game files. Let’s dive into the methods to resolve these issues effectively.

Update Graphics Drivers

Outdated graphics drivers can cause compatibility issues leading to crashes or freezes. Updating drivers ensures compatibility with the latest software. Ideal for users with outdated PC components.

  1. Visit the website of your graphics card manufacturer (NVIDIA, AMD, Intel).
  2. Download the latest driver compatible with your system.
  3. Install the driver and restart your computer.

Replace Master Key

Outdated or incorrect master keys in Ryujinx can lead to compatibility issues with games, causing crashes or freezes.

  • Open the Ryujinx emulator on your PC.
  • In the Ryujinx window, click on the ‘File’ option located at the top right corner.
  • Choose ‘Open Ryujinx Folder’ to open the directory where Ryujinx is installed.
  • Inside the Ryujinx folder, find and open the ‘System’ folder.
  • This is where the master key file is located.
  • Open your web browser.
  • Go to a trusted source to download the updated master key. Ensure the website is safe and the key is compatible with your Ryujinx version.
  • After downloading, navigate to the folder where the new master key is saved.
  • Copy the master key file.
  • Return to the ‘System’ folder in the Ryujinx directory.
  • Paste the new master key, replacing the old one.
  • Close the Ryujinx emulator.
  • Reopen it to ensure it loads with the new master key.
  • Run a game or application in Ryujinx to test.
  • Check if the issue with crashing or freezing has been resolved.

Check System Requirements

Ryujinx has specific hardware requirements. Ensuring your system meets these requirements can prevent crashes. Users with older or lower-spec PCs.

  1. Check Ryujinx’s minimum system requirements.
  2. Compare with your PC’s specifications.
  3. Upgrade hardware if necessary.

Update Ryujinx to the Latest Version

Developers continuously release updates to fix bugs and improve performance. Keeping Ryujinx updated can prevent many common issues.

  1. Open Ryujinx and check for any available updates.
  2. Download and install the latest version.
  3. Restart Ryujinx to apply the updates.

Check for Software Conflicts

Other software can interfere with Ryujinx’s operation. Identifying and resolving these conflicts can eliminate crashes.

  1. Temporarily disable or uninstall potentially conflicting software.
  2. Test Ryujinx for stability.
  3. Re-enable software one at a time to identify the culprit.

Verify Game File Integrity

Corrupted or incomplete game files can cause crashes. Verifying integrity ensures all game files are correct and complete. Users experiencing crashes with specific games.

  1. Locate the game files within Ryujinx.
  2. Use built-in tools or external software to verify file integrity.
  3. Replace or repair any corrupted files.

Adjust In-Emulator Settings

Incorrect settings within Ryujinx can cause performance issues. Tweaking these settings can optimize performance.

  1. Open Ryujinx settings.
  2. Adjust graphics, audio, and controller settings for stability.
  3. Test different configurations to find the most stable setup.

Check for Overheating Issues

Overheating can cause your system to freeze or shut down. Monitoring and controlling your system’s temperature can prevent crashes.

  1. Monitor your system’s temperature using hardware monitoring tools.
  2. Ensure proper ventilation and consider additional cooling solutions if necessary.
  3. Clean dust from your PC and check for proper fan operation.

Reinstall Ryujinx

A fresh installation can resolve unidentifiable software issues. Reinstalling removes any corrupted files and settings. Users who have tried all other methods without success.

  1. Uninstall Ryujinx completely, including all associated files.
  2. Download the latest version from the official website.
  3. Install Ryujinx and test its performance.

FAQs

Q1: Can antivirus software cause Ryujinx to crash?

Yes, sometimes antivirus programs mistakenly identify Ryujinx as a threat, causing it to crash. Try adding Ryujinx to your antivirus exception list.

Q2: How do I know if my game file is corrupted?

If Ryujinx crashes consistently while loading a specific game, the file might be corrupted. Try re-downloading the game or verifying its integrity if possible.
